Students in the two kindergarten classes taught by Mrs. Sharon Deitz and Mrs. Angie Miller braved the cold temperatures Wednesday of last week and went to the Depot restaurant for lunch as part of a study on nutrition.
According to their teachers, the students completed food pyramids and both planned and constructed a place setting complete with paper food. The children practiced their social skills by using their best manners in a real world situation at the Depot. Full story
Local and area high school music students are preparing their vocal and instrumental solos and ensembles for the annual District 8 solo and ensemble contest to be held this Saturday, Feb. 6, at Massillon Washington High School.
According to Carrollton High School Band Director David Dickerhoof, 13 instrumental soloists and six instrumental ensembles from CHS will compete in Saturday’s event which is open to the public.

Chosen as Students of the Month for January at Carrollton High School are Cari Molnar and Taylor Thompson.
Daughter of AJ and Dawn Molnar of 405 5th St. NW, Carrollton, Cari ranks 1st academically in her senior class of 184 members with a 4.0 grade point average (GPA). Upon graduation, Cari plans to attend the University of Akron and major in chemical engineering.
Cari has two sisters, Ashley and Stacy, and is a four-year member of the volleyball team at CHS, Student Council, National Honor Society and Caring, Helping, Sharing (CHS) Club. Full story
